8 RepliesIt was removed as it couldn't be counted on to show what was really going on. A connection half way around the world would be red bar simply due to distance and not real quality fo the connection. While nobody wants to play a match with a red bar.. Bungie ultimately took it out to protect players from other players.. same with the lack of open world mics where you could just run into people and chat like many other games. All was designed to protect players from others.
